Right then, let's have a proper look at this scrap at the bottom of Serie A. Cagliari versus Genoa - two sides who've been finding life tough this season, and something's got to give.
Cagliari are sitting in 14th with 10 points, and honestly, their recent form hasn't been clever. They've managed just 3 wins in their last 10 games, and at home, they've been proper hit and miss. They lost 0-2 to Bologna, got turned over 1-2 by Sassuolo, and even Inter came to town and put two past them without reply. Their only decent home result recently was that 2-0 win against Parma, but let's be honest, Parma aren't exactly setting the world alight either.
Genoa, bless 'em, are in even worse shape down in 18th with only 7 points to show for their efforts. They've won just 2 of their last 10, and defensively they've been about as solid as a chocolate teapot - shipping 1.60 goals per game on average. Away from home, they've been particularly shocking, winning only 20% of their travels. That said, they did nick a 2-1 win at Sassuolo recently, so maybe there's a bit of fight left in them yet.
When these two have met in the past, it's usually been tight stuff. Out of 8 meetings, 4 have been draws, and both teams have found the net in half of those encounters. The recent head-to-heads show 1-1, 2-2, and 0-0 results - not exactly goal fests, but plenty of both teams scoring.
Looking at the stats, both sides have been pretty generous at the back. Cagliari are letting in 1.30 goals per game at home, while Genoa are leaking 1.60 on their travels. At the same time, both have been finding the net regularly enough - Cagliari scoring in 50% of their recent games, Genoa in 70% of theirs.
The bookies have got this as a proper 50-50 job with both teams priced at 2.75 for the win, which tells you everything you need to know about how close they expect this to be. Given both teams' defensive woes and their tendency to both score and concede, I'm leaning towards both teams getting on the scoresheet here.
